What does "Tie-breaking" mean?
Table of Contents
- Importance in Algorithms
- Tie-breaking in Auctions
- Tie-breaking in Optimization Algorithms
- Conclusion
Tie-breaking is a method used to make a decision when two or more options are equally good or when no clear winner can be identified. Think of it as a friendly referee deciding who gets the last donut when everyone's hands are reaching for it. In many situations, especially in competitions or algorithms, tie-breaking helps clarify who or what should be chosen when choices clash.
Importance in Algorithms
In algorithms, especially those dealing with complex problems like auctions or multi-objective optimization, tie-breaking plays a crucial role. When an algorithm has to choose among multiple equally good solutions, a tie-breaking rule helps establish a clear path forward. This can improve the effectiveness of the algorithm and help it reach a solution quicker. After all, no one wants to be stuck forever in a loop of indecisiveness!
Tie-breaking in Auctions
In the context of auctions, tie-breaking becomes especially interesting. Imagine several people wanting the same item but offering the same maximum bid. A tie-breaking rule comes in handy to decide who walks away with the prize. For example, a common method might be to give the item to the person who bid first. It’s like getting a second chance at a dessert that’s just too good to resist!
Tie-breaking in Optimization Algorithms
In optimization algorithms like NSGA-II, which are used to solve problems with many objectives, the tie-breaking rule can help manage choices effectively. When the algorithm faces multiple options that seem equally viable, a good tie-breaking strategy can ensure that the process moves forward smoothly. If the choices stall, it’s like watching a game of chicken where no one wants to budge!
Conclusion
Tie-breaking is not just about making decisions—it’s also about getting things done! Whether in competitions, auctions, or complex algorithms, having a clear way to resolve ties is vital. It helps ensure that progress continues without long pauses and that everyone knows who gets to claim victory (or dessert). So next time you face a tough choice, remember the importance of a good tie-breaking rule—it might just save the day!